The Acer Palmatum Oridono-Nishiki, also known as Oridono-Nishiki Japanese Maple, is a stunning deciduous tree that is native to Japan. This tree has a slow to moderate growth rate and can reach a height of 4-6 meters with a spread of 3-4 meters when fully mature. The Acer Palmatum Oridono-Nishiki has an upright habit with a well-branched crown that provides a beautiful, natural canopy.
One of the most remarkable features of the Acer Palmatum Oridono-Nishiki is its beautiful foliage. The leaves are deeply lobed and have a unique variegation of green, pink and white. The variegation of the leaves gives a beautiful and eye-catching display of colour. In the autumn, the leaves turn to shades of orange, red, and gold, providing a striking display of colour.
The Acer Palmatum Oridono-Nishiki prefers a position in partial shade to full sun, in well-drained soil. This tree can tolerate a range of soil types, but it prefers slightly acidic soil. It is important to note that this tree is sensitive to drought and requires consistent moisture. It is best to water this tree regularly during the growing season, particularly during dry periods.
The Acer Palmatum Oridono-Nishiki blooms in the spring with small, insignificant flowers. The flowering time is usually between March and April. The tree is self-fertile and does not require any pollination to set fruit. The fruit produced by this tree is a double-winged samara that ripens in the autumn.
